Summary

Authorizing the governing body of Howard County, after consultation with the State Board of Chiropractic and Massage Therapy Examiners, to adopt ordinances or regulations relating to verification, inspection, and display of specified licenses issued under specified provisions of law; and requiring the governing body of Howard County to provide that the Howard County Health Officer and the Howard County Police Department have specified authority to carry out specified provisions of ordinances or regulations.
